titleOfInvention Scintillator input screen for an X-ray image intensifier, and method of manufacturing such a scintillator
abstract The present invention relates to a scintillator for the input screen of a tube for intensifying radiological images, the needles (2) of cesium iodide of the scintillator being coated with a refractory, transparent or reflecting material (5) close to or less than that of cesium iodide. Various methods can be used for the coating, such as chemical vapor deposition, activated by thermal excitation, plasma excitation, or photonic excitation; or such as the diffusion deposit of a colloidal solution; or such as the polymerization of a polymer resin. After the coating, the heat treatment is carried out which ensures the luminescence of the screen.
